#7cd62d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7cd62d is composed of 48.6% red, 83.9%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 79%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 92 degrees, a saturation of 67.3% and a lightness of 50.8%. #7cd62d color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ff5a with #00ad00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#7cd62d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7cd62d has RGB values of R:124, G:214,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 8181293.
